The police is reminding drivers not to cut through a road in Douglas whilst it closed for work.
The Eastern Neighbourhood Policing Team says it’s had a number of complaints about people ignoring road closed signs on Groves Road.
It says this can cause safety issues for people living and working in the area.
The road shut is shut between Pulrose Road to the entrance of the National Sports Centre and will reopen on Tuesday, January 21 next year.
